Output 59d7e20c59324e3f5894239898489101397ca5504e9c234e560f10df9deaae39:23

value
145412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e90f114ea5b43e8445a65ae12e132d638f55ed OP_EQUAL
address
3GMqET3tDfyaCAWodQ7aMi7rBunXgu5g7g
transaction
59d7e20c59324e3f5894239898489101397ca5504e9c234e560f10df9deaae39
spent
true